Greetings and welcome to another Harr Travel youtube video! Today we are talking about private islands, and if they are possibly the secret to cruising early in deployment. Interested in booking with Harr Travel? https://res.harrtravel.com/contact Many of the large brands have invested heavily in their private island experiences. Royal Caribbean's Coco Cay is nothing short of spectacular. NCL's large renovations of both Harvest Caye, and Great Stirrup Cay provide an amazing private experience for suite guests that we haven't seen from any other line. Disney's Castaway Cay brings the magic of the mouse to a relaxing island getaway. And lastly MSC and Virgin also have amazing island destinations. With the port restrictions in place early on these private islands will provide the cruise lines flexibility to provide an amazing experience for their guests with possible bonus time! Who wouldn't want a Symphony of the Seas sailing with more Coco Cay? Or a NCL cruise with extra nights in their beautiful suite villa area? There are a lot of ways the cruise lines can utilize these amazing spaces, and we think it may just be an even better experience for many guests.
